Howard Ludwig is a neighborhood reporter at DNAinfo Chicago, covering Beverly, Mount Greenwood and Morgan Park.
 
Prior to joining DNAinfo, Howard wrote a weekly parenting column based on his experience as a stay-at-home dad. The syndicated column appeared in five suburban newspapers including the SouthtownStar and The Daily Journal in Kankakee. The column was based on Howard's daily interactions with his two sons. Howard "Bubba" Ludwig was born on June 14, 2006. Peter Ludwig was born on November 24, 2007.
 
Howard worked as a business reporter and editor prior to the arrival of his two children. He's lived in Morgan Park since 2007.
 
Fun fact: Howard still owns his first car - a 1967 Chevy II Nova. He and his father (also named Howard) restored the car together, prepping the hot rod for the drag strip. Howard's best time in the quarter mile is a 10.57 second pass.
